Jagriti Upcoming 29th October 2025 Written Update: Jagriti’s Grief and Akash’s Mysterious Return. The upcoming episode of Jagriti promises to be a mix of heartbreak, guilt, and suspense. The story takes an emotional turn as Jagriti, still reeling from her mother’s death, performs Geeta’s final rites. Every flame of the pyre burns into her conscience, reminding her of the unbearable choice she made — shooting her own mother to protect the nation. Ganga stands beside her, asking her to cry her heart out and free herself from the storm within.

Suraj and Sapna, too, try to comfort Jagriti. They remind her that what she did wasn’t a sin but a soldier’s duty. Geeta had become a danger to innocent lives and the Defence Minister, and Jagriti’s action saved many. Yet, even as her loved ones try to heal her, Jagriti’s silence speaks of deep emotional torment. She has done her duty, but the guilt doesn’t let her rest.

As the family begins to move forward, a shadow looms nearby — someone is seen watching Jagriti from a distance. Their identity remains hidden, setting up an eerie mystery for the next track. Later, Suraj realizes Jagriti isn’t in her room. He panics and calls her, but she doesn’t answer. Just when fear grips everyone, Jagriti returns home calmly, carrying bags from the market. She says she went out to buy items for Chhath Puja. Her attempt to appear normal hides the turmoil raging inside her.

During the Chhath Puja, Jagriti, Ganga, and Sapna perform the rituals together. The moment is sacred and peaceful — until Kalindi’s sharp tongue strikes. Kalindi taunts Jagriti, reminding her that as a child, she had once kept a fast to save her mother’s life, and today she’s performing the same ritual after killing her. Her words pierce Jagriti like knives. Jagriti’s eyes well up as she silently bears the insult.

Suraj immediately steps in to defend her, scolding Kalindi for being heartless. Wanting to lighten Jagriti’s mood, Suraj arranges for some children to perform a small play at home. His intention is sweet, but fate plays a cruel trick — the play unexpectedly mirrors Jagriti’s memories of Geeta. The resemblances are too painful. Jagriti’s mind spirals into trauma, and she suffers a panic attack right before everyone. Suraj rushes to her side, apologizing for his well-meant but ill-timed effort. He tells her he only wanted to see her smile again. Jagriti, still trembling, asks him to leave her alone.

The night takes a darker turn when Sapna senses someone in her room. Fear creeps in as she slowly turns around, only to have her mouth covered before she can scream. When the person steps into the light, she freezes — it’s Akash. His sudden and secretive return shocks her, leaving viewers guessing: Is Akash back as a savior, or is this the beginning of a new storm in Jagriti’s life?

The upcoming episode packs emotion, guilt, and mystery — promising that Jagriti’s battle is far from over.
